Hydraulic system of recirculation of deep waters without external energy contribution (Machine-translation by Google Translate, not legally binding)

摘要

Hydraulic system of recirculation of deep waters without external energy contribution, of the type of system of pumping of liquids to superior level with optimized autonomy, in which the potential energy of water dammed to a certain height is harnessed to produce directly usable mechanical energy in the elevation of the flow of water at a level above, even of the discharge, which has been adapted to raise water from great depth, as for example in wells or flooded mines, characterized to be constituted by a combination of hydraulic turbine Pelton type (1) and centrifugal pump (2) by mechanical transmission of multiple axis (3) between the corresponding runners, in which, taking advantage of the operation's own infrastructure, such as wells, chimneys, galleries or hillsides, or building infrastructure specific, the turbine is located at a lower level determined by a height "H" of a drain point (4) of a vol umen of the deep water, used as a source of potential energy, whose jet impinges on the blades or spoons of the turbine driven in free fall through a pipe or pressure gallery (5) ending in "N" number of needle valves or injectors, from where it exits towards a channel, well or lower tank (6), and the pump is submerged in a point of the volume of the deep water located in an upper level of the previous drain point, used for the evacuation towards the outside of the well or of the water mine of the upper level of drainage (7), in such a way that the revolving drive of the impeller of the turbine as a consequence of the jet of water under pressure that falls from the upper drain point, is transmitted through the multiple axis to the impeller of the centrifugal pump, causing the suction of the water from the drainage area, from where it is channeled towards the outside, either to a fluvial channel or to an accessory installation, such as a supe deposit land (8) (Machine-translation by Google Translate, not legally binding)
